James Lin

James Lin

James Lin is a senior software engineer at Google. He is a member of the Google Design Platform team, working on Relay. His past work at Google includes software engineering productivity research and software infrastructure for Google Search and A/B experiments. His research interests include end-user programming and user interface design tools. James has a PhD in computer science from the University of California, Berkeley and previously worked at IBM Research.
Authored Publications
Sort By
  • Title
  • Title, descending
  • Year
  • Year, descending
    Relay: A collaborative UI model for design handoff
    Tiffany Knearem
    Kris Giesing
    ACM Symposium on User Interface Software and Technology (2023)
    Enabling the Study of Software Development Behavior with Cross-Tool Logs
    Ben Holtz
    Edward K. Smith
    Andrea Marie Knight Dolan
    Elizabeth Kammer
    Jillian Dicker
    Caitlin Harrison Sadowski
    Lan Cheng
    Emerson Murphy-Hill
    IEEE Software, Special Issue on Behavioral Science of Software Engineering (2020)
    Argos: Building a Web-Centric Application Platform on Top of Android
    Rich Gossweiler
    Colin McDonough
    IEEE Pervasive Computing, 10(4) (2011), pp. 10-14